Address

vtc1q3ae4m46afz2ccwzj4dmzwq5suz7da3nxp7tz7pCopy

Total Received

19.63630933 VTC

Total Sent

19.63630933 VTC

№ Transactions

2

Final Balance

0 VTC

Transactions
Filter